Function and Operation

The Press Regulator Spring 217152 operates within the fuel system to maintain consistent fuel pressure. It works in conjunction with other components to ensure that the engine receives a steady supply of fuel, which is necessary for efficient combustion and overall engine performance. The spring’s design allows it to respond to changes in fuel pressure, helping to maintain a consistent flow of fuel to the engine under varying conditions 1.

Lubricating Oil Pump

The lubricating oil pump is another area where the Press Regulator Spring is instrumental. The pump is responsible for circulating oil throughout the engine to lubricate moving parts, reduce friction, and dissipate heat. The spring ensures that the pressure within the pump remains within optimal levels. This is achieved by regulating the flow of oil and maintaining a steady pressure, which is essential for the effective lubrication of engine components. Proper lubrication is key to preventing overheating and mechanical failure, thereby enhancing the overall efficiency and lifespan of the engine 3.
